Abstract:

The initial treatment of a poisoned patient in most of Iran’s hospital centers is done by interns orgeneral doctors or even specialists who do not have enough knowledge and experience in the fieldof poisoning, and there is a possibility of mistakes and not considering important things duringthis treatment.Our goal is to use this application, which does not have a similar example, to remind the learneror the doctor or the treatment staff of the correct steps to deal with a poisoned patient in detail andby observing a logical and scientific sequence, so that the possibility of errors and mismanagementof treatment, At least, at the same time, it is possible to perform a comprehensive evaluationthrough it.After researching and checking the technology used for coding and implementing the project, thePHP language was selected for implementation in the backend of the project, and the implementationof the MySQL database tables has been done to determine the required records.In this design, every part of the training will be stored dynamically and its content can be changedin the future.Also, for the quiz section, the pro-quiz plugin is used, which has the ability to create differentquestions with various fields, and the results of each student’s test can be seen by the professor.There will be no restrictions in creating questions and their order.Also, the activity of each student while working with the educational system, which steps he/shewent through in what period of time, has been designed in the database.After the end of the coding, the training of working with the system was prepared in the formof a video, and after testing by the end user, the observed bugs were fixed. Also, in this phase, anew feature of the white list for student registration was added to the project. In this feature, theprofessor can enter the list of students’ information in the form of student code and national codein the form of an Excel file in the software database, and at the time of registration, if a person isincluded in the list, his registration will be automatically confirmed.In addition, it is possible to define the login code for other users and learners by the system administrator.
